Summary
  1. The first in a series of three plays produced for television, based on a medieval, religious theater form called the mysteries or 'mystery cycles'. The plays, which recount the life of Christ, were first performed at the National Theatre in London in 1985. The remaining two plays, The nativity and The Passion, are available on NCOX 5464 and 5463 respectively.
